Transaction 1396f073edd99a8114014e76706bfb612693b4f6121e0dd4c64958d8045bd5fb

1 Input
2 Outputs
  • 1396f073edd99a8114014e76706bfb612693b4f6121e0dd4c64958d8045bd5fb:0
  • value  58635
    address  3PPbP3TwbnE91KjmTJ2c9Vu9kKhBGTHCEp
  • 1396f073edd99a8114014e76706bfb612693b4f6121e0dd4c64958d8045bd5fb:1
  • value  17998209
    address  bc1qxnwqqq9q6ku4n6cfvtzywv3z3v4jhksuhwfpaknc0dqeee63ampq28d2v7